Geeta Dutt

A versatile playback singer who could breathe life into her songs, Geeta Dutt was known for the freshness and charm of her voice. Born Geeta Roy, she moved to Bombay with her parents at the age of 12. Even though she lacked formal training in classical music, she impressed music director Hanuman Prasad enough to ...

Asha Bhosle

Gifted with a voice that possesses extraordinary range and versatility, Asha Bhosle has to her credit over 10,000 songs in 14 languages. Together with her legendary sister Lata Mangeshkar, Bhosle has dominated the Indian film singing for more than five decades. Born in Satara, Maharashtra, she received musical training from her father, Dinanath Mangeshkar. She ...

Amirbai Karnataki (1906-1965)

Amirbai Karnataki (born around 1906, died March 3, 1965) was a famous actress/singer and playback singer of the yesteryears and was famous as Kannada Kokila. Mahatma Gandhi was an ardent fan of her song Vaishnav Jaan. Amirbai Karnataki was born in Bilgi village, District of Bijapur in Karnataka into a lower middle class family. Of ...

Tarana

Although she was originally from Iran, Tarana made herself very much at home in Pakistan’s dances and movie worlds. She was discovered by a Lahore filmmaker while waltzing and fox-trotting at Karachi’s myriad dance halls. The movie that made her immensely famous throughout the country, Jaan Pehchan, also starred another Iranian actress, Shahpara, with Mohammad ...

Shahpara

Shahpara was renowned Iranian actress who was invited by producer Mohsin Shirazi (later a popular host of TV chat shows) to work in his production Jaan Pehchan (1967). It was shot under the direction of Fareed Ahmed on locations that were never seen before in Pakistani movies. The Khewra salt mines in the rugged and ...

Rahman

In an era ruled by Waheed Murad, Mohammad Ali and later Nadeem, Rahman was the only Bengali actor-director to rule the box office with his romantic-musical films in the former West Pakistan film industry. Born Abdur Rahman on February 27, 1937, in erstwhile East Pakistan, Rahman made his film debut in Ehtesham’s Bengali film, Ae ...

Nabeela

Nabeela was popular supporting actress of Pakistani cinema, mostly active in 60s and 70s. She is best remembered for her powerful performance as Tangawallah‘s wife in Badnaam (1966), a film based on Saadat Hassan Manto’s short story Jhumke. The film depicted the tragedy in the life of an upright Tangawallah (Allauddin) who refuses to be ...
